Did some more work over my holiday break. Driver quarter is finished. New roof skin installed. All the seams filled with Mar Glass just need to finish with a skim coat of filler. As you can see in the one picture the 70-72 chevelle roof skin had to be trimmed to fit the Monte roof line. Wasn't to bad I just took my time trimming.

A little start to finish. The driver outer cowl was in pretty bad shape. Once I got it off I had the rebuild the inner structure and fix a bad spot just below the lower door hinge. Not sure why but these inner cowl panels have no holes in them to drain. Is this a Monte thing or are Chevelles this way also? I know the Novas have a drain at the bottom but they have a cowl panel. The Monte hood is large and covers the cowl, maybe by design they thought no drain was necessary.
